#2b7b54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b7b54 is composed of 16.9% red, 48.2%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.7%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 150.8 degrees, a saturation of 48.2% and a lightness of 32.5%. #2b7b54 color hex could be obtained by blending #56f6a8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#2b7b54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b7b54 has RGB values of R:43, G:123,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 2849620.

Shades and Tints of #2b7b54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020705 is the darkest color, while #f7fc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b7b54
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#515553 is the less saturated color, while #05a155 is the most saturated one.
